This study explores the antitubercular activity of alpha-viniferin, a bioactive phytochemical compound obtained from Carex humilis. alpha-Viniferin was active against both drug-susceptible and -resistant strains of Mycobacterium tuberculosis at MIC(50)s of 4.6 mu M in culture broth medium and MIC(50)s of 2.3-4.6 mu M inside macrophages and pneumocytes. In combination with streptomycin and ethambutol, alpha-viniferin exhibited an additive effect and partial synergy, respectively, against M. tuberculosis H37Rv. alpha-Viniferin also did not show cytotoxicity in any of the cell lines tested up to a concentration of 147 M, which gives this compound a selectivity index of >32. Moreover, alpha-viniferin was active against 3 Staphylococcus species, including methicillin-susceptible Staphylococcus aureus (MSSA), methicillin-resistant Staphylococcus aureus (MRSA), and methicillin-resistant Staphylococcus epidermidis (MRSE).
